Biographical Information[edit]

T.J. Harrington has been a coach. He was drafted by the San Diego Padres in the 43rd round of the 1994 amateur draft out of high school but opted for college. He was a clubhouse assistant to the 1995-1998 Adirondack Lumberjacks, then was assistant strength coach at Siena College in 2001-2002. In 2003-2004, he was strength and conditioning coach for the Salt Lake Stingers. He was Niagara University's strength and conditioning coach in 2004-2005. In 2006-2007, he was roving strength and conditioning coordinator for the Los Angeles Angels. In 2008, he became the Angels' Strength and Conditioning Specialist.
